Monarch Butterflies butterfly collection It is indigenous to MalaysiaThe monarch butterfly (Danaus plexippus) is a famous North American butterfly with vibrant orange, black, and white wings. They are renowned for their yearly migrations, traveling thousands of miles from Canada and the United States to overwintering sites in Mexico and California.
